Richardson Electronics [RELL]
The thesis is driven by the fast-growing, higher-margin Green Energy Solutions (GES) segment. The company is seen as a misunderstood "demand dust" business with a venture portfolio of products. The author believes the company's operations have reached an inflection point for sustainable revenue growth and profitability. The base case suggests a fair value of $25 per share and a price target of $45 by FY27, driven by 11% revenue growth. The author acknowledges governance concerns due to the CEO's controlling stake but believes the secular trends and growing backlog offer significant upside.
